SS-HORSE method for studying resonances

  • 1. Moscow State University, Skobeltsyn Institute of Nuclear Physics (Russian Federation)
  • 2. Pacific National University (Russian Federation)

Description

A new method for analyzing resonance states based on the Harmonic-Oscillator Representation of Scattering Equations (HORSE) formalism and analytic properties of partial-wave scattering amplitudes is proposed. The method is tested by applying it to the model problem of neutral-particle scattering and can be used to study resonance states on the basis of microscopic calculations performed within various versions of the shell model.
